Output 95ddcc0682127021b706af2e82a268fd7f3b7d86512a06b08a742e7e86782d52:1

value
878735990
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c221e28b3a07d041fe15485f53b2e33cb37ed051 OP_EQUAL
address
MRbdv1eZXNZRb8efski6yhpqxPguNuEbf4
transaction
95ddcc0682127021b706af2e82a268fd7f3b7d86512a06b08a742e7e86782d52
spent
true